We recently extended a warm welcome to both The Glasgow Barons street orchestra and Primary 3 pupils from Oakwood Primary to Platform!
Since 2017, The Glasgow Barons have been uniting communities through music, bringing joy to schools and community centres across Govan and beyond. This January, their incredible street orchestra are on tour, visiting ‘Baby Strings’ schools across Glasgow and spreading the magic of music.
As well as touring primary schools they paid a special visit to Platform where their orchestra entertained and engaged the Oakwood Primary pupils, who had headed to the venue for the afternoon.
The pupils joined in with percussive rhythms whilst watching the conductor, whilst one pupil tried out the role of orchestra conductor….well done!
As well as wonderful live music from the orchestra, there was discussion led by Artistic Director & Conductor Paul MacAlinden around topics such as having an identity that no-one can take from you, the right to an opinion, the right to share what you think or have privacy of that opinion, the right to happiness and a look at self-reflection and what emotions and images music conjours up.
Another topic was the musical rights for children from the International Music Council, looking at the right to express yourself musically in all freedom, the right to learn musical languages and skills and access to musical involvement through participation, listening, creation and information.
